想做到在24C256上读写数据,必须要掌握单片机的I2C通信知识,掌握这个对于其他外设也基于I2C通信的就可以引用了! I2C 有四条连接线,SCL、SDA、VCC、GND。 I2C的通信协议: 数据若要传输,传输前必须由SCL...
24C256_C程序
24C256程序控制原理[文].pdf
Android 9 读写eeprom at24c256 linux 读取eeprom相对来说比较简单,因为内核中集成了大部分eeprom的驱动,文件目录在kernel/drivers/misc/eeprom/at24.c 。 而且我们不用区分at24cxx的不同容量导致的读写方式不同,...
CC最近推出了多款大容量存储的Arduino 开发板,涵盖了EEPROM FLASH FRAM SD等,今天我来给大家介绍第一款 基于AT24C256的 容量高达32K eeprom开发板。
at24c256开发代码,自己编写的代码已经测试过的,可以用的。
24C02和24C256均是EEPROM(电可擦除可编程只读存储器)芯片的型号。下面我将分别从功能、特点和应用方面回答这个问题。 对于24C02芯片,它是一种2K位(256字节)容量的串行EEPROM。它通过I²C总线进行数据的读写...
通过51单片机的I/O口模拟IIC接口AT24C256:256K串行CMOS EEPROM
AT24C256在单片机系统中的应用,非常有用!
24C256驱动代码 for Arduino A0,A1,A2高电平,地址 0x50 int deviceaddress = 0x50 ; void writeTest() { Wire.begin(); unsigned int address = 0; writeEEPROM(address, 123); Serial.print
STM32F429IIT6单片机I2C的使用(代码)--EEPROM使用安森美的AT24C256(借鉴野火教程)
硬件平台STM32F407ZGT6,AT24C256软件平台MDK5,GPIOG_PG2->SCL,GPIOG_PG3->SDA,属于软件模拟IIC问题描述在用逻辑分析仪分析时序时发现时序完全没问题,如图:向地址为7FFFH的地址写0X55: 对地址为7FFFH的地址读...
本文将介绍如何使用STM32F1微控制器和STM32CubeIDE来编写设备驱动程序,以实现对EEPROM存储器AT24C256的控制。通过按照上述步骤,您就可以在STM32F1微控制器上使用STM32CubeIDE编写设备驱动程序,实现对AT24C256 ...
EEPROM AT24C256C的英文原版资料
BL24C256超高性价比EEPOM,SOIC8,TSSOP8两种封装都有。-BL24C64A.pdf
24c256是一种IIC总线接口的EEPROM存储器,它可以通过IIC协议与微控制器进行通信。在使用Python语言控制24c256时,我们首先需要通过硬件连接将24c256与微控制器连接起来,然后使用Python编写相应的程序来实现读写数据...
at24c256与at24c02的区别在于以2个字节来控制地址 其中首字节最高位忽略,其余7位和下一字节的高2位 构成9位的页地址,共512页,低字节的剩余6位为页内地址,共64BYTE。 另外要注意的是整片写数据时在翻页时需要给...
#include <reg52.h> #include <intrins.h> #define ERROR 10 //允许出错次数sbit SDA=P3^3 sbit SCL=P3^4 sbit LED=P1^7
typedef enum I2CChannel{TM4C_I2C0 = 0,TM4C_I2C1,TM4C_I2C2,TM4C_I2C3,TM4C_I2C4,TM4C_I2C5,TM4C_I2C6,TM4C_I2C7,TM4C_I2C8,TM4C_I2C9,TM4C_I2C_NUM,}tI2CChannel;typedef struct{uint8_t ulSCLPins;...
AT24C256PDF是指AT24C256芯片的电子数据手册(PDF格式)。AT24C256是Microchip Technology生产的一种串行电子式可擦除可编程只读存储器(EEPROM)芯片。它具有256K位的存储容量,可以存储32K字节的数据。AT24C256由...
用C语言写的AT24C系列的EPROM读写程序,适用于刚学单片机编程的初学者
Proteus8.9的VSM Studio使用的SDCC仿真_STC15W4k32S4_013_iic_08_AT24C256编程代码和仿真操作实验
在单片机的工业控制中,当系统从新上电时,一定要注意AT24C256存储器的数初始化操作过程
模拟IO口通信方式下的,与AT24C256(EEPROM)的I2C通信程序
接上面的文章!!! 第五步:我们要封装2个函数,一个用于读8位数据,一个用于写8位数据,程序如下: 第六步:我们要利用上面2个函数再封装2个函数,一个用于向EPPROM指定的地址写指定的一字节数据,一个用于...
AT24C256是一种高性能、低功耗的、可编程的24C系列串行EEPROM芯片,总容量为32K x 8位。 STM32和AT24C256是可以配合使用的。作为微控制器,STM32可以通过I2C总线与AT24C256进行通信。AT24C256作为存储设备,可以...
AT24C256的存储程序,测试正确.可以进行任意字节,任意地址存入,任意字节,任意地址取出。
ft24c256a是一种常见的串行I2C EEPROM芯片,它具有256K位的存储容量,可以存储32K字节的数据。为了实现对ft24c256a的读写操作,我们需要编写一个驱动程序。 首先,我们需要在系统中加载I2C总线驱动,确保可以访问...